Average Computer Science Teachers, Postsecondary Salary in Kansas City, MO-KS
The average salary for Computer Science Teachers, Postsecondarys in Kansas City, MO-KS is $90,820. While this is lower than the national average, the cost of living in Kansas City, MO-KS may offset the difference, preserving real purchasing power.
Executive Summary
- Average Salary: $90,820 per year.
- Growth Trend: Salaries have shifted 10.8% ↗ over the last 5 years.
- Top Earners: Senior professionals (90th percentile) earn up to $148,050.
- Outlook: The current demand for Computer Science Teachers, Postsecondarys is stable, with a local workforce of approximately 100 professionals. This role remains a specialized component of the broader Kansas City, MO-KS economy.

Frequently Asked Questions
How much does a Computer Science Teachers, Postsecondary make in Kansas City, MO-KS?
The median annual salary for a Computer Science Teachers, Postsecondary in Kansas City, MO-KS is $90,820. This typically ranges from $50,410 for entry-level positions to $148,050 for top-level roles.
How does the salary compare to the national average?
The average salary for this role in Kansas City, MO-KS is 10.7% lower than the national median of $101,750.
